This book, framed in the processes of engineering analysis and design, presents concepts in mechanics of materials for students in two-year or four-year programs in engineering technology, architecture, and building construction; as well as for students in vocational schools and technical institutes. Using the principles and laws of mechanics, physics, and the fundamentals of engineering, Mechanics of Materials: An Introduction for Engineering Technology will help aspiring and practicing engineers and engineering technicians from across disciplinesmechanical, civil, chemical, and electricalapply concepts of engineering mechanics for analysis and design of materials, structures, and machine components.
The book is ideal for those seeking a rigorous, algebra/trigonometry-based text on the mechanics of materials.

Dr. Parviz Ghavami was born on January 10, 1943 in Iran. He studied his early and secondary education in Esphahan. He continued his education towards university degree and received a Master of Science degree in mechanical engineering. He stayed on engineering field from 1965-1978, and worked as a design engineer and senior project engineer for overseas industries both in Iran and abroad.
